I potty trained my son at 20 months old right before my second child was born. I just told him it was time to go to the bathroom like all of his favorite people i.e grandpa and grandma and mommy and daddy! I lead by example by letting him in the bathroom with me and saying " see mommy use the toilet like a big girl and you can too." I also go him excited about flushing!! But the best tip I can share that worked for my son is to make a HUGE deal when he does use the toilet clapping and shouting yay! He loved it!
